Cattle Q&A with Bernard Rollin

July 1, 2011
Bernard Rollin
Bernard Rollin is a professor of animal science at Colorado State University and a prominent scholar on animal rights. He has written numerous articles and books on animal welfare and spoken to cattlemen in several states about animal use ethics. His new autobiography is titled “Putting the Horse before Descartes.” He spoke with Progressive Cattleman about animal welfare in today’s cattle industry.

Global beef roundup: Huge Australian beef company optimistic in rapid growth

July 1, 2011
Clint Peck
A global food shortage, currency moves and good old-fashioned rain have seen the stars align for listed cattle producer Australian Agricultural Company, which has forecast a strong return to profitability and tapped the market for a fresh $86 million in capital. A year into a three-year turnaround after struggling with losses, AACO said it expected pre-tax earnings in 2011 of about $60 million to $65 million.

Major changes looming ahead for U.S. beef industry

July 1, 2011
The cow/calf segment of the U.S. beef industry lost about 175,000 producers over the past 20 years, which equates to a loss of nearly 9,000 cow/calf producers per year.
